What is an assessment of mental health?

A psychiatric examination is an examination conducted by a psychiatrist that helps identify the exact disorder you suffer from. It is a crucial step that opens the way to treatment options that are tailored to your needs.

A mental health evaluation involves an interview with a doctor as well as a variety of other tests. It begins with the doctor looking over your medical and family history. A psychiatrist might also suggest lab tests to rule out physical problems that could cause symptoms.

Next, the doctor mental health assessment will assess your appearance, mood and behavior. They may ask you about the severity of the symptoms and the type of help that you have tried in the past. They'll also inquire about your friends, family and work routine to determine how the issues are affecting your daily activities.

The psychiatrist will take note of your body language, eye contact and facial expressions as he or she interviews you. They will also observe how much and how well you express yourself. The way you speak to a patient can tell a lot about their mental state. If you are speaking less than usual, this could indicate anxiety or depression. In contrast, if you're speaking too much, it could be a sign of bipolar or manic depression disorder.

Another vital aspect of a psychiatric examination is a review of systems. This includes asking about any physical symptoms you've experienced recently and also the use of any drugs recently and any previous medical diagnoses. This aspect of the examination is crucial because it can help identify any physical issues that could be the cause of your mental illness. If you have suicidal feelings it is essential to identify the root of the problem like thyroid problems or neurological issues.

The psychiatrist then will conduct clinical tests to assess cognitive functioning. These tests typically involve asking a patient to respond quickly, either verbally as well as in writing, to specific words or phrases. These tests are designed to measure a patient’s ability to think clearly and quickly.

Psychological testing is often used to help determine the cause of certain Mental Health Assessment Center Near Me health symptoms, whether it's an anxiety disorder or an att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der. These tests and assessments can help your mental health professional create an assessment that will form the basis for your treatment plan.

There's no universal psychological assessment and the exact tests your psychologist or psychiatrist chooses to use will depend on the root of the issue and your specific symptoms. Some of these may include tests that are standardized, such as a IQ test or a neuropsychological examination. These can provide your mental health professional with a more detailed assessment of your capabilities and how those are affected by your symptoms as well as your ability to concentrate, learn, communicate, and control your emotions.

Psychological evaluations can also include tests for personality and behavior. They tests can help your mental health professional gain a better understanding of the genetic, environmental and social elements of your personality, so they can figure out what might be causing your problems.

A psych evaluation will typically start with a short clinical interview. Your mental health professional will inquire with you about your symptoms and how they have affected your life. They'll also ask you what you've done to manage them. They'll also review your personal and family histories to determine if any factors may be contributing to your symptoms.

It's important to be truthful during the clinical interview so that your mental health professional has a complete understanding of the issues you're experiencing. You'll be asked about your moods and sleep habits as well as how you interact with others. You might be asked to fill out a questionnaire.

Psychological evaluations can be an uncomfortable experience, however it is essential to be as truthful as you can so that your mental health professional will have the best chance of getting the appropriate treatment for you. What is a psychometric assessment?

Psychometric assessments are commonly used in the recruitment process to evaluate a candidate's personality and cognitive abilities. They can be a useful method of quickly and objectively assessing a candidate's suitability for an occupation, as well as identifying traits that are difficult to pick up in an interview, such as logical reasoning or numerical ability.

A psychometric test is generally a timed test that will consist of several questions. Some tests are written verbally, while others use the format of logical or numerical numbers. It is important to prepare thoroughly for a psychometric assessment before taking it so that you are confident in your capabilities and know what to expect. It is recommended to practice using practice questions from psychometric tests to get familiar with the style and format of the test, and to learn the time it will take you to complete each question.

It is important to not look at the answers of other candidates while taking psychometric tests. This can affect your answers. Additionally, it is important to study the instructions thoroughly because they will provide you with details on how the test should be completed. This will prevent any mistakes that may result in an lower score than you expected.

The most commonly used psychometric test is called the intelligence test, also known as the IQ test. This test evaluates the level of a candidate's general intelligence ability. It was originally developed in France by Alfred Binet and Theodore Simon, and then adapted to be used in the United States by Lewis Terman of Stanford University.

Psychometric tests are often used in combination with other methods of selection like interviews and work samples. They are also used by businesses as part of their ongoing talent management programs.
